A chunky, rounded print style with softly bulging strokes and visibly hand-shaped curves. Terminals are blunted and irregular, with subtle wobble and uneven joins that create an organic rhythm rather than a geometric one. Counters are compact and slightly asymmetrical, and the overall texture is dense, with simplified forms and minimal detailing that keeps lettershapes bold and direct. Numerals match the same soft, simplified construction, reading clearly with a slightly quirky, drawn feel.

It suits short, attention-grabbing text where personality matters: packaging, posters, labels, stickers, social graphics, and cheerful headlines. It can also work for kid-oriented materials or playful brand accents, especially at medium to large sizes where the rounded shaping and quirky details stay crisp.

The font projects an upbeat, approachable tone—more friendly than formal—suggesting doodled lettering and casual signage. Its soft weight distribution and rounded corners lend a warm, humorous character, with a lightly retro, cartoon-like charm.

The design appears intended to mimic bold hand-printed lettering with a friendly, approachable silhouette—prioritizing charm and immediacy over strict typographic precision. Its simplified, rounded construction suggests a goal of reliable readability while maintaining a distinctly informal, drawn-by-hand texture.

Spacing and sidebearings feel intentionally loose and airy for a hand-printed face, helping prevent the heavy strokes from clogging in text. The irregularities are consistent across uppercase, lowercase, and figures, reinforcing a cohesive handmade voice without becoming messy.
